the angles of quadrilateral are in rotio 2:3:5:8 then greatest angle is​

Complete step-by-step answer:

Now, we have the ratio of angles as 2 : 3 : 5 : 8. Let the first angle be 2x, so then according to the ratio, the angles will be 2x,3x,5x,8x. Hence, x=20∘. So, the angles will be 40∘,60∘,100∘,160∘.

Step-by-step explanation:

In quadrilateral

2x + 3x + 5x + 8x = 360

18x = 360

x = 20

greatest angle = 8x = 8×20 = 160°
